The arrival of two-year molars, also known as next molars, generally is a milestone shrouded in irritation for equally toddlers as well as their caregivers. These 4 flat, grinding teeth mark the completion of a Kid's infant teeth established, erupting at the rear of the main molars that arrived in all around 1 12 months previous. While the identify implies a precise timeframe, the emergence of two-year molars can come about any where between 23 and 33 months, with a few toddlers suffering from the procedure earlier or later on.

The main reason behind the fuss encompassing two-calendar year molars lies in their dimension and placement. In contrast to their predecessors, these molars erupt even further back during the mouth, pushing as a result of additional gum tissue. This extra strain can translate into heightened irritation for toddlers. The extensive surface place of such molars also contributes on the intensity of teething, as extra gum really should be damaged by for them to totally arise.

Signs of two-yr molars can closely resemble These of earlier teething episodes. Improved drooling is a common indicator, as your body ramps up saliva creation to soothe and numb the irritated gums. Chewing gets a toddler's Major coping system, with something from favored toys to apparel using the brunt in their attempts to alleviate the force. Crankiness and irritability will also be for being expected, since the distress disrupts a toddler's typical regime and snooze patterns. Some toddlers may well practical experience a slight fever, commonly very low-grade and all around 99°F (37.two°C).

Whilst teething is undoubtedly an unavoidable Component of childhood, there are ways to help you your minor one particular navigate the distress of two-yr molars. Teething rings and mesh feeders filled with chilled fruits or greens can provide A lot-required pressure and coolness to sore gums. A delicate massage around the gums having a clean finger might also offer you temporary aid. Above-the-counter pain relievers appropriate for a toddler's age and weight might be administered underneath the advice of a pediatrician to control any lingering pain.

It is important to keep in mind that just about every toddler experiences teething in a different way. Some could sail throughout the emergence of two-12 months molars with small fuss, while some may well require a lot more help. Persistence and knowledge are critical through this time. Here are a few further ideas to aid your toddler by means of teething:

Supply lots of soft, neat foods that happen to be simple to chew. Mashed fruits, yogurt, and steamed veggies are all great selections.
Let your toddler suck on the interesting, damp washcloth.
Distraction might be your friend. Interact your toddler in playtime or sing music to get their intellect off the distress.
Manage a constant bedtime program just as much as feasible, 2 year molars whether or not teething disrupts slumber patterns.

In case you observe any indications beyond the usual teething woes, speak to your pediatrician. Signals that warrant a doctor's go to include things like too much fussiness, fever above a hundred.four°F (38°C), problems sleeping that persists for numerous evenings, or bleeding gums.
